Output 21455aba31b63f7aaf3d906753c08c7969080bc5da901e3c7578d6b910c2cc8a:1

value
150000
script pubkey
OP_0 OP_PUSHBYTES_20 e2589aef5efea28bccdde99140fa6f5e53b4334d
address
bc1qufvf4m67l63ghnxaaxg5p7n0tefmgv6ddkd8fe
transaction
21455aba31b63f7aaf3d906753c08c7969080bc5da901e3c7578d6b910c2cc8a
spent
true